Contained within the pages of this book are the stories behind the most
notorious murders in Cheshire's history. Alan Hayhurst re-examines some
of the crimes that shocked not only the county but Britain as a whole.
Alan Hayhurst is a former Honorary Secretary of the Police History
Society. A retired bank manager, he has been researching the history of
crime in Cheshire and Lancashire for 25 years. He is a 'speaker on
matters criminal' to societies and clubs, and has lectured on Dr Crippen
at New Scotland Yard. He has written articles on crime and criminals and
assisted in the production of Hideous Crimes: The Secrets of the Black
Museum, Channel 5 2003. He was recommended to The History Press by
Stewart Evans (murders series consulting editor) and has written the
Lancashire volume in the county murder series.
